Output 63e4a341440844a41cf78f01c7fc85d5f60c03c6416fe7b61e079a24bd3c4a79:1

value
1600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a372f54c57f05ea5ad53fb0e44dd7a6b0fd308d OP_EQUAL
address
35YEQuxLa2pqYsQuutZcD2jDfYa9eHaBrY
transaction
63e4a341440844a41cf78f01c7fc85d5f60c03c6416fe7b61e079a24bd3c4a79
spent
true